Here are the top highlights within ten miles of Guerneville:
Downtown Guerneville (2 min walk): Explore the charming shops, restaurants, and bars in downtown Guerneville. There's something for everyone, from local boutiques to art galleries to wine tasting rooms.
Russian River (5 min walk): The Russian River is a popular spot for swimming, kayaking, canoeing, and paddleboarding. There are also a number of outfitters that rent out equipment.
Armstrong Redwoods State Natural Reserve (1.6 miles away): Home to some of the tallest trees on Earth, this reserve is a must-visit for nature lovers. Hike among the towering redwoods and explore the lush forests.
Johnson's Beach (5 min walk): A popular spot for swimming, sunbathing, and kayaking on the Russian River. There's also a playground and picnic area, making it a great place for a family outing.
Pee Wee Golf and Arcade: Enjoy a fun-filled day of mini-golf and classic arcade games. Perfect for a group outing or a rainy day activity.
Korbel Champagne Cellars (2.9 miles away): Take a tour of the Korbel Champagne Cellars and learn about the champagne-making process. Enjoy a tasting of their award-winning sparkling wines.
Northwood Golf Club (3.1 miles away): A challenging 18-hole golf course set amidst the rolling hills of Sonoma County. Beautiful scenery and a great test of your golfing skills.
Porter-Bass Vineyard (2.9 miles away): Sample a variety of wines at this family-owned and operated vineyard. Enjoy the beautiful views of the surrounding vineyards and countryside.
Bohemian Grove: A private members club located in the redwoods near Guerneville. The club is known for its annual summer encampment, which has been attended by many famous people over the years.
West Sonoma Coast State Park (12.3 miles away): This park offers stunning ocean views, hiking trails, and tide pools to explore. It's a great place to escape the crowds and enjoy the natural beauty of the California coast.

The town was founded in the 1850s by the Guerne family, who were French immigrants. Guerneville was originally a logging town, but it soon became a popular vacation destination for San Franciscans. In the early 1900s, then later became a popular destination for the LGBTQ+ community. The town's liberal atmosphere and its proximity to San Francisco made it a safe and welcoming place for LGBTQ+ people.
